PEKAN PANTAI REMIS, Pengkalan Bharu, 34900, Manjung, Perak, Malaysia
Pekan Pantai Remis in Manjung, Perak recorded 2 subsale transactions in 2024, with a median price of RM776K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M210.
This area consists exclusively of commercial properties, with no residential listings recorded.
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M776K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M652K to RM900K, and a typical market range of RM714K to RM838K.
Most transactions involved 3 - 3 1/2 storey shop, though some variety exists in the market.
The median PSF stands at RM210, with core pricing between RM175 and RM245. Market pricing typically extends from RM165.63 to RM254.13, reflecting moderate variation in unit pricing.
